Developer Tools
south-african-id-validator vs validate_nigerian_phone
A verified, side-by-side comparison. Both records are status-checked by Findra, so you are comparing what each actually offers today, not a stale listing.
Category
Developer Tools
Developer Tools
Type
Validation
Validation
Country
🇿🇦 South Africa
🇳🇬 Nigeria
Docs status
Docs live
Docs live
Licensing
Pricing
Free / open-source
Free / open-source
Verified
Verified
Verified
Last verified
24 Jun 2026
24 Jun 2026
Tags
kyc, javascript, south-africa, typescript, id-validation
validation, nigeria, python, phone, pypi
Summary
TypeScript-native validator for 13-digit South African ID numbers that checks the Luhn checksum and extracts date of birth, gender and citizenship status. Zero runtime dependencies, runs on Node, Bun, Deno and browsers.
A Python (PyPI) package to validate and format Nigerian phone numbers with is_valid(), formatted(), get_network() and is_mtn() helpers. Maintained by djunehor.